This yarn is beautifully soft and gentle next to the skin and the bamboo gives strength and a light sheen for a slightly luxurious look.

The Merino wool used to create this yarn is from small farms employing ethical farming practices and the sheep are not mulesed. The bamboo is a sustainably grown resource and is raw bamboo (not viscose which is chemically processed).

Superwash yarns can be gently machine washed in cool water using a wool wash however for best results we recommend always hand washing woollen garments.
